A popular Kenilworth pub is set to reopen today (January 9) less than three months after it closed its doors.

The Gauntlet has been shut since the middle of October after previous tenant Simon Moore decided he did not want to continue running the Oaks Precinct venue.

Simon, who had run the pub since 2018, told Nub News in September he was "very sad" to be letting the pub go and said he had "put everything into making this one of the best community pubs around".

Since then landlord Stonegate Group has been looking for a new tenant.

But the pub has taken to social media to announce it will once again be open to customers today.

"We would like to take this opportunity to thank the previous manager, Simon, for all he did for the community and running a successful pub," the Facebook post said.

"There are many questions people will have, with raised concerns, and we will do our best to answer a couple now.

"Firstly, The Gauntlet is managed by an independent group, thus Stonegate have no involvement in the day to day running of the pub.

"This has and will always be a community pub, listening to concerns and recommendations that you have. We will always listen!

"Starting in February we plan to reintroduce different themed nights so please speak to our new manager, Elliot, if you have any ideas.

"There are many exciting new things to look forward to at The Gauntlet, starting this month!"

The post said Sky Sports and BT Sport will return by next weekend, and the refurbished kitchen will start serving food from January 16.
